Today's expression very good.
It's a phrasal verb and it is to quibble.
Over. To quibble over something.
Q U I B B L E and then over to quibble to quibble over something.
Now listen to the word.
Why do we quibble? Say it.
Quibble. Does quibble sound like a strong word?
Or a weak word? Quibble.
Quibble. I don't know, to me it sounds like a weak word.
W -E -A -K, not very strong, right?
Yeah, and that's the idea.
If you quibble over something, you are arguing about something.
You are fighting about something.
but it's not serious it's something little the argument is not serious the subject is not serious husbands and wives good friends they always quibble over things you know not too much salt oh I this is not in us this is I need a little bit more salt now that's too much so all this is this is less salt than I had yesterday no I saw what you had yesterday you had more salt than that you had the bla bla bla bla, this is the idea of to quibble over, to argue about something not so important.
It's not a serious argument, but it's a fight, it's a small fight.
